Transaction 9324e7a1c88be6251ffbfb80e7ca422ebeffa5519598e87bf0220855793286e4

1 Input
2 Outputs
  • 9324e7a1c88be6251ffbfb80e7ca422ebeffa5519598e87bf0220855793286e4:0
  • value  239820
    address  12s3GneQduzrDe8VufEzA1jWdWA5wJTiBX
  • 9324e7a1c88be6251ffbfb80e7ca422ebeffa5519598e87bf0220855793286e4:1
  • value  67244059
    address  139zYwRTrQ6fj1cv8c7Xy5aCR29D3fTUXh